Telehandler Operator required for an immediate start in Hereford, Herefordshire.

Requirements:

  • Tickets: BLUE CPCS REQUIRED.
  • PPE: Hard hat, high vis, steel toe cap boots.
  • Experience: Must have 2 years' experience working as a Telehandler on other construction projects.
  • References: Must be able to provide 2 recent work references.

Job role: Housing site.

Pay: Weekly pay on a Friday Β£20/ph.

Other information:

  • Working hours: 7:30am - 4.30pm.
  • Ivy has lots of work in the local area so the potential to be kept busy through our agency if you work well on site.
